Rapid Identification and Typing of Herpes Simplex Virus in Clinical Specimens by a Direct Microneutralization Test

Abstract: Now that various drugs for treating patients suffering from herpes simplex virus (HSV) infections are available (I, 3, 5, 6, 11), it is desirable to give a quick and accurate diagnosis by a method feasible for clinical laboratories. It is also necessary to determine the type of HSV to trace the route of infection as well as to accumulate data for epidemiological analysis.
